Benefits of Attic Insulation

A properly insulated attic keeps heat in during the winter and out during the summer, Atlanta, GA the workload on your heating and cooling systems, and significantly lowering your energy costs. It also protects the attic space from moisture buildup, which can damage and weaken the structure of your home. And, since many types of insulation are effective at preventing the penetration of outside noise, proper attic insulation creates a quieter indoor environment.

Moisture control is another significant benefit of attic insulation, which prevents condensation and mold from forming in the attic, thereby extending the life of your roof, walls, and attic structure. In addition, a lack of attic insulation often contributes to a high humidity level in the living spaces, which is uncomfortable and can lead to a variety of health problems. Insulation helps reduce humidity levels, improving indoor air quality.

There are several different types of insulation available, including fiberglass batts and blankets, mineral wool, and cellulose. In general, these materials are effective in reducing energy loss and can be installed by either professional contractors or DIYers. Another type of insulation is spray foam, which expands upon application and seals gaps effectively. It is typically used in attics with uneven joist spacing and limited headroom for maneuvering, and it requires the use of special machinery.

Optimizer Smart and its successor, the Optimizer Smart Mini, provide Cardiac Contractility Modulation (CCM) therapy to help patients with chronic heart failure find relief and reduce their symptoms. CCM therapy uses precisely timed electrical pulses to the heart cells during a unique period of the beat cycle, called the absolute refractory period, to strengthen and help the heart contract more forcefully and deliver more blood and oxygen to the body. Studies have shown that CCM therapy can improve the 6-minute hall walk distance and quality of life in patients with NYHA Class III heart failure who remain symptomatic despite guideline-directed medical therapy, are not appropriate candidates for CRT, and have an LVEF between 25% and 45%.

The device is implanted in a pocket under the skin in the upper chest, similar to the size of a pacemaker. It’s delivered under light sedation and can be placed quickly with no open-heart surgery. After implantation, the device is custom-programmed to meet each patient’s needs and requires external charging one hour per week. It is expected to last at least 20 years without requiring replacement.
